Your Impact
- Work closely with the functional teams to understand their perspectives, processes, applications, projects and technologies to ensure compliance with applicable privacy and data security laws, regulations, and industry best practices while guiding and delivering solutions for the teams
- Work with legal colleagues at global level to facilitate implementation of privacy and security tools and processes
- In collaboration with legal colleagues and functional leaders, conduct privacy and data impact assessments and other security assessments
- Support all members of the legal team in proactively addressing privacy and related security requirements as they impact or apply to their areas of responsibility
- Support privacy compliance efforts across the company, and with external stakeholders as needed, address privacy audits and facilitate development and implementation of tools, policies, procedures, etc.
- Partner with the Information Security and Information Technology teams to implement best practices for management and protection of confidential and personal information and to develop appropriate policies and standards
- Provide legal advice and direction to all stakeholders across the company on matters regarding privacy and data protection, including supporting commercial counsels on privacy negotiations
- Develop and deliver training and communications on privacy and security matters
- Manage outside counsel on privacy matters
